Basic law enforcement training to be offered in Chillicothe

According to Livingston County Sheriff Steve Cox, the Missouri Sheriff’s Association Training Academy will offer a Basic Law Enforcement Training Academy class in Chillicothe, Mo. beginning on August 2, 2016. The academy training is a 700 hour Basic Peace Officer Academy that exceeds the State of Missouri minimum basic training requirements for peace officer licensing. […]

DWI saturation in Caldwell County leads to two arrests

An increased effort by the Missouri State Highway Patrol to detect impaired drivers and other traffic violations in Caldwell County resulted in two arrests for driving while intoxicated (DWI), 11 traffic citations, and 53 warnings. The effort, which was referred to as a “DWI saturation”, was Saturday night, March 19th into the early morning hours […]
